BricsCAD

<p>BricsCAD gives you a familiar workspace to create 2D drafts and 3D models without the high cost of traditional subscriptions. You can open and edit your existing DWG files directly, ensuring your legacy data remains fully accessible and accurate. The platform combines standard drafting tools with advanced features like AI-driven BIM workflows and mechanical assembly design, all within a single, unified interface that feels immediately recognizable if you have used other CAD tools.</p> <p>You can choose how you want to buy and deploy the software, whether through permanent licenses or flexible subscriptions. It serves everyone from solo architects to large engineering firms across the construction and manufacturing sectors. By using a single platform for different design disciplines, you reduce the need for multiple software packages and simplify your team's collaborative workflow.</p>

PV*SOL

<p>PV*SOL provides you with a comprehensive environment for designing and simulating photovoltaic systems of all sizes. You can create detailed 3D models of buildings, visualize shading from nearby objects, and accurately predict energy yields based on global climate data. The software handles everything from small rooftop installations to large-scale solar farms, helping you determine the most efficient module coverage and inverter configurations for any site.</p> <p>You can generate professional reports that include technical specifications and detailed economic forecasts to present to your clients. By simulating battery storage systems and electric vehicle charging integration, you can optimize self-consumption and prove the long-term viability of solar investments. It simplifies complex engineering calculations into a manageable workflow, ensuring your solar projects are both technically sound and financially profitable.</p>
